跳至內容

Consolas

本頁使用了標題或全文手工轉換
維基百科,自由的百科全書
Consolas
Consolas
樣式等寬字型無襯線體
設計師Lucas de Groot英語Lucas de Groot
發行商微軟
創造日期2006年11月,​18年前​(2006-11
許可專有字體
Consolas sample text
範例

Consolas是一套等寬的字型,屬無襯線字體,由荷蘭設計師盧卡斯·德格魯特英語Lucas de GrootLucas de Groot)設計。這個字型使用了微軟ClearType字型平滑技術[1],並隨同Windows VistaOffice 2007[2]Microsoft Visual Studio[3]中發行,或可在微軟的網站下載。在Windows Vista的6套新字型中,Consolas近似於舊版Windows中的2款內建字型:Lucida ConsoleCourier New,主要是設計做為代碼的顯示字型之用,特別之處是它的「0」字加入了一斜撇,以方便與字母「O」分辨。

在Consolas之前,代碼的顯示字型大多為Courier New或其他等寬的字型,字型的柔邊(反鋸齒)效果則依個人喜好選擇開啟或關閉,然而Consolas是專為柔邊效果而設計的字型,特別是為了搭配微軟的ClearType技術,如果不開啟ClearType,Consolas的顯示效果會打大折扣。另外,ClearType技術還需要搭配液晶顯示器才會有最佳表現。

程式碼編寫的應用

[編輯]

程式設計師在Windows環境底下,一般都會使用Courier New或其他近似的固定字元寬度字型來顯示程式碼。

通常用來編寫程式碼的程式都會讓編程員選擇用來顯示程式碼的字體,因為Courier New的字型比較肥大,使每個畫面或頁面所能顯示的程式碼大為減少。Consolas除了能夠在較少的空間顯示更多的內容,它的清晰字型亦使程式設計師能夠更快捷的分辨每一個文字。

替代字體

[編輯]

範例

[編輯]

下列分別使用Consolas和Courier New顯示已啟動ClearType技術的C++/CLI程式碼。由於Consolas支援ClearType,所以在LCD顯示屏可以利用次畫素優視技術來使字體更清晰。

Consolas

[編輯]

Courier New

[編輯]

參考資料

[編輯]
  1. ^ Van Wagener, Anne. The Next Big Thing in Online Type. The Design Desk. Poynter Online. 2005-03-04 [2006-06-05]. (原始內容存檔於2006-06-04). 
  2. ^ Microsoft Office Compatibility Pack for Word, Excel, and PowerPoint File Formats. Microsoft. [2013-02-19]. (原始內容存檔於2018-04-29). 
  3. ^ Consolas Font Pack for Microsoft Visual Studio 2005. Microsoft. 2006-05-03 [2007-09-02]. (原始內容存檔於2019-09-24). 
  4. ^ Google Fonts. Google Fonts. [2017-08-11]. (原始內容存檔於2016-10-20). 

外部連結

[編輯]